Reliquary Of Ra Impact Of Cleopatra

Reliquary Of Ra Impact Of Cleopatra
Play Reliquary Of Ra Impact Of Cleopatra, a slot game by St 8. Experience exciting gameplay with high-quality graphics and engaging features.
Barbara Bang Reliquary Of Ra Impact Of Cleopatra - Wikibet